44.
Saying, "Good, friend," the bhikkhus delighted and rejoiced in the
Venerable Sariputta's words. Then they asked him a further question: "But,
friend, might there be another way in which a noble disciple is one of right
view... and has arrived at this true Dhamma?" -- "There might be,
friends.
45.
"When, friends, a noble disciple understands contact, the origin of
contact, the cessation of contact, and the way leading to the cessation of
contact, in that way he is one of right view... and has arrived at this true
Dhamma.
46.
"And what is contact, what is the origin of contact, what is the cessation
of contact, what is the way leading to the cessation of contact? There are
these six classes of contact: eye-contact, ear-contact, nose-contact,
tongue-contact, body-contact, mind-contact. With the arising of the sixfold
base there is the arising of contact. With the cessation of the sixfold base
there is the cessation of contact. The way leading to the cessation of contact
is just this Noble Eightfold Path; that is, right view... right concentration.
47.
"When a noble disciple has thus understood contact, the origin of contact,
the cessation of contact, and the way leading to the cessation of contact... he
here and now makes an end of suffering. In that way too a noble disciple is one
of right view... and has arrived at this true Dhamma."
